What Is a Ductless Mini Split, and Why Do Marlborough Homes Suit Them?

A ductless mini split is a high-efficiency heating and cooling system with two main parts: a slim outdoor compressor and one or more indoor air-handling units mounted on walls, ceilings, or floors. According to the U.S. Department of Energy, these systems connect the outdoor and indoor units with a small refrigerant line that needs only a roughly three-inch hole through an exterior wall — no bulky ductwork required. Each indoor head creates its own comfort zone, so you can heat or cool only the rooms you are using.

That zoning is a natural fit for Marlborough. Much of the local housing stock — older downtown housing, mid-century homes, and large modern subdivisions — was built before central air was common, or uses heating systems that never had ducts at all. Retrofitting traditional ducted systems into these homes is expensive and invasive. A ductless system sidesteps that problem entirely, which is why the Department of Energy notes that mini splits are especially valuable for homes with non-ducted heat, room additions, and older construction.

Do Mini Splits Really Work Through a Marlborough Winter?

This is the single most common question we hear in Marlborough, and the answer is yes. Older heat pumps struggled in deep cold, but today’s cold-climate (hyper-heat) models from manufacturers like Mitsubishi Electric and Daikin are engineered to deliver full or near-full heating capacity at outdoor temperatures well below 0°F. Given Marlborough’s cold, snowy winters and hot, humid summers common to eastern Massachusetts, we specifically size and select cold-climate equipment so your home stays warm on the coldest January nights.

The key is correct design. A unit that is undersized will struggle in a cold snap, while an oversized one short-cycles and wastes energy. Sizing and System Selection

Sizing is where good installs are won or lost. Capacity is measured in BTUs, and the right number depends on a room’s square footage, ceiling height, insulation, window area, sun exposure, and how the space is used. A typical Marlborough bedroom might need a 6,000–9,000 BTU head, while an open living area could call for 12,000–18,000 BTUs. Whole-home comfort usually means a multi-zone system with one outdoor unit serving several indoor heads, each independently controlled.

We also help you choose the right indoor unit style for each room. Wall-mounted heads are the most common and affordable choice for Marlborough bedrooms and living rooms. Ceiling cassettes recess into the ceiling for a nearly hidden look, floor-mounted units work well under windows or in rooms with limited wall space, and slim concealed-duct air handlers can serve a couple of small adjacent rooms from one discreet unit. Matching the head style to the room is part of what makes a finished install look intentional rather than tacked on.

Common Installation Mistakes We Help You Avoid

A mini split is only as good as its installation. When we take over or inspect work in Marlborough, the problems we see most often include:

  • Incorrect sizing — equipment chosen by square footage alone rather than a real load calculation.
  • Poor outdoor unit placement — too low for local snowfall, or with inadequate clearance for airflow.
  • Sloppy line-set routing and finishing that looks messy on the exterior of the home.
  • Inadequate vacuum and refrigerant charging, which quietly robs the system of efficiency and lifespan.
  • Skipped permits and inspections, which can create problems at resale.

Protecting Your Investment: Maintenance Basics

Mini splits are low-maintenance, but a little care keeps them efficient for 15 to 20 years. For your Marlborough home, rinse the washable indoor filters every few weeks during heavy use, keep the outdoor unit clear of leaves and snow, and schedule one professional tune-up a year so we can check refrigerant levels, coils, drainage, and electrical connections. This simple routine protects both your comfort and your warranty.

Mini Split Cost and Mass Save Rebates in Marlborough

A single-zone mini split commonly runs in the range of $3,500–$6,000 installed, while multi-zone whole-home systems often fall between $8,000 and $18,000 depending on the number of zones and equipment tier. The good news for Marlborough homeowners is that Massachusetts offers some of the strongest incentives in the country.

  • Mass Save rebates: The statewide Mass Save program offers substantial heat pump rebates plus 0% HEAT Loan financing for qualifying Marlborough homes. We break down current amounts on our Mass Save heat pump rebates guide.
  • Federal tax credit: The federal 25C credit covers 30% of the cost of a qualifying heat pump, up to $2,000 — see the federal tax credits for energy efficiency.
  • Long-term savings: Lower operating costs versus oil, propane, or electric resistance heat add up season after season.

Stacked together, these incentives can take thousands of dollars off the up-front price of going ductless in Marlborough.

16. What is a ductless mini split system?

It is a heating and cooling system made up of an outdoor compressor and one or more indoor air-handling units connected by a small refrigerant line, with no ductwork needed.

17. How does a mini split differ from central air?

Central air uses ducts to distribute conditioned air, while a mini split delivers heating and cooling directly into each room through individual indoor units, eliminating duct losses.

18. How many indoor units can one outdoor unit support?

Most residential systems support up to four to eight indoor heads on a single outdoor unit, depending on the model and total capacity.

19. What does “ductless” actually mean?

It means the system conditions rooms directly without any duct network — only a small refrigerant line and electrical connection run between the indoor and outdoor units.

20. Can a mini split both heat and cool?

Yes. A mini split heat pump reverses its refrigerant cycle to provide cooling in summer and heating in winter from the same system.

21. How energy efficient are mini splits?

Very. ENERGY STAR–certified ductless units transfer heat instead of generating it and avoid duct losses, so they often use far less energy than electric resistance heat or window units.

28. What size mini split do I need?

It depends on room size, insulation, ceiling height, windows, and sun exposure. A professional load calculation determines the correct BTU capacity rather than guessing from square footage.

29. What happens if my mini split is oversized?

An oversized system short-cycles, turning on and off too often, which wastes energy and fails to control humidity properly. Correct sizing prevents this.

30. Do mini splits help with humidity?

Yes. In cooling mode they dehumidify as they cool, and many models offer a dedicated dry mode for muggy summer days.

36. What is a multi-zone mini split?

It is a single outdoor unit connected to multiple indoor heads, each controlled independently so different rooms can be set to different temperatures.

37. What is SEER2 and HSPF2?

SEER2 measures cooling efficiency and HSPF2 measures heating efficiency. Higher numbers mean more efficient operation and lower running costs.

45. Do mini splits need refrigerant refills?

No. A properly installed sealed system should never need refrigerant added. If it loses charge, there is a leak that needs repair.

46. Will an indoor unit drip water inside my house?

Not if it is installed correctly. Condensate is carried away through a drain line; improper drainage is a sign of installation error.

50. How efficient are mini splits compared to baseboard heat?

Far more efficient. Heat pumps can deliver several units of heat per unit of electricity, while electric baseboard converts energy at roughly one to one.
